Understanding Weather Forecasting for Accurate Rain Timing
Accurately predicting rain timing requires sophisticated methods and careful interpretation. Understanding these processes is key to making informed decisions.
Different Forecasting Methods
Several methods contribute to rain prediction, each with its strengths and weaknesses:
- Radar: Uses radio waves to detect precipitation and its intensity. Strengths include real-time monitoring of rainfall; limitations include limited range and potential interference.
- Satellite Imagery: Provides a broad overview of cloud cover and atmospheric conditions. Strengths include wide coverage; limitations are lower resolution compared to radar and difficulty in precisely pinpointing rainfall location.
- Numerical Weather Prediction (NWP) Models: Complex computer models that simulate atmospheric processes to forecast weather patterns. Strengths include long-range prediction potential; limitations include reliance on initial data accuracy and simplifying complex atmospheric interactions. These models consider factors such as atmospheric pressure, temperature gradients, and humidity levels to calculate precipitation probability.
Interpreting Weather Forecasts
Understanding weather maps and terminology is essential for accurate rain timing interpretation:
- Rainfall amounts are often expressed in millimeters (mm) or inches. Higher numbers indicate heavier rainfall.
- Precipitation probability (%) represents the chance of measurable rainfall occurring at a specific location within a given time frame. A 70% chance means there's a 70% likelihood of rain.
- Timing windows indicate the period when rain is most likely to occur. Pay attention to the start and end times specified in the forecast. Understanding concepts like frontal systems, convection (rapid upward movement of air), and isobars (lines of equal pressure) will enhance your interpretation.
Limitations of Rain Timing Predictions
While forecasting has improved significantly, predicting rain timing with perfect accuracy remains challenging:
- Unpredictable weather patterns, such as sudden thunderstorms, are difficult to forecast accurately.
- Technological limitations in data collection and model resolution affect the precision of predictions.
- Local geographic factors, like mountains and valleys, can influence rainfall patterns and make precise predictions more difficult.
